Output 8948ef8863e3fb8ae34c7354f658ec0c692e46204a30e6efb193fab43a6d80ae:0

value
21020750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0103704edb85ddbbdef741db61f9c966f4574851 OP_EQUAL
address
M7zX2YhQTisRiSDxV438fDxp84uZw6fsoB
transaction
8948ef8863e3fb8ae34c7354f658ec0c692e46204a30e6efb193fab43a6d80ae
spent
true